Understanding the Role of IT Consulting
IT consulting involves providing expert advice and services to help organizations improve their IT infrastructure and operations. For SMEs, this can mean anything from implementing new software systems to enhancing cybersecurity measures. Here are some key areas where IT consulting can make a significant impact:
1. Strategic Planning
A well-defined IT strategy is essential for any SME looking to grow. IT consultants can help you assess your current technology landscape and develop a roadmap that aligns with your business goals. This includes:
Identifying technology gaps: Understanding what tools and systems you currently have and what you need to succeed.
Setting priorities: Determining which IT initiatives will deliver the most value to your business.
Budgeting: Creating a financial plan that supports your IT strategy without breaking the bank.
2. Cybersecurity
With cyber threats on the rise, protecting your business's sensitive data is paramount. IT consultants can help you implement robust cybersecurity measures, including:
Risk assessments: Evaluating your current security posture and identifying vulnerabilities.
Security protocols: Establishing policies and procedures to safeguard your data.
Training: Educating your staff on best practices for data protection.
3. Cloud Solutions
Cloud computing offers SMEs flexibility and scalability, allowing you to access resources as needed. IT consultants can guide you in:
Choosing the right cloud services: Whether it's public, private, or hybrid cloud solutions, consultants can help you find the best fit for your business.
Migration planning: Ensuring a smooth transition to the cloud with minimal disruption.
Cost management: Monitoring cloud usage to avoid unexpected expenses.
4. Software Development and Integration
Custom software solutions can streamline operations and improve efficiency. IT consultants can assist with:
Identifying needs: Understanding your unique business requirements to develop tailored software solutions.
Integration: Ensuring that new software works seamlessly with existing systems.
Support and maintenance: Providing ongoing assistance to keep your software running smoothly.

Choosing the Right IT Consulting Partner
Selecting the right IT consulting partner is crucial for your SME's success. Here are some factors to consider when making your choice:
1. Experience and Expertise
Look for a consulting firm with a proven track record in your industry. They should have experience working with SMEs and a deep understanding of the challenges you face.
2. Range of Services
Ensure that the consulting firm offers a comprehensive range of services that align with your needs. This includes everything from cybersecurity to software development.
3. Client Testimonials
Check for client testimonials and case studies that demonstrate the firm's ability to deliver results. This can provide valuable insight into their capabilities and reliability.
4. Communication and Support
Effective communication is essential for a successful partnership. Choose a consulting firm that prioritizes clear communication and offers ongoing support.
5. Cost Structure
Understand the consulting firm's pricing model and ensure it fits within your budget. Look for transparency in their fees and any additional costs that may arise.
